Challenges in Implementing HCM KB APIs

Overcoming Implementation Challenges in HCM KB APIs

Implementing HCM Knowledge Base APIs, such as the Oracle HCM and Workday API, presents several challenges that organizations often navigate. As companies strive for seamless integration with existing systems, understanding these hurdles becomes essential. Firstly, there is the challenge of data compatibility. Different API versions may require specific data formats, necessitating updates to current systems to ensure a smooth data flow. Misalignment in data integration paths can lead to errors and inaccurate employee data being processed, impacting the quality of content delivered by the knowledge base. Secondly, ensuring secure and efficient access to mandatory information remains a key concern. An organization’s ability to manage API requests effectively ensures that employee and client data are protected. Employing best practices in API management can mitigate risks related to unauthorized access and data breaches. Additionally, managing release notes and updates can be complex, especially when operating multiple systems like Oracle Fusion and the ADP API. Keeping track of the latest update or method post can be challenging for HR managers, as frequent changes in the system might require regular adjustments in the application’s integration logic. Moreover, organizations must address connectivity issues related to network disruptions or API downtime. Maintaining a stable connection between the knowledge base and user systems is crucial for the continuous operation of an HCM cloud environment. Ensuring redundancy and robust integration systems can mitigate these risks significantly.
